Abstract
PID control (Proportional-Integral-Derivative) has been widely researched and studied topic of automatic control for decades. While other, more sophisticated control methods have been introduced, PID control has still remained as a bread and butter control method for most control applications. This paper presents some fundamental, elegant and general observations on SISO (Single-Input-Single-Output) PID control without knowledge on the process model, or in some cases, with using only the minimum knowledge of the process model.
